Welcome Charlie Parnell
 Perry-Mansfield welcomed its newest year-round employee this month:
Charlie Parnell,
Business and Facilities Manager
A native of Wisconsin, Charlie has lived in nine states and traveled to over 25 countries before moving his family to Steamboat Springs 10 years ago from Geneva, Switzerland where he was the European Marketing Manager for a medical company. Graduating with a Ph.D. in Chemistry from Yale University, he has experience in Fortune 500 companies, entrepreneurial start-ups, teaching high school, and recently was the Administrative Pastor of a local church. His spare time is filled with family and outdoor activities of every sort. Charlie is thrilled to join the Perry-Mansfield staff and being actively involved in the life-changing education that happens to everyone affiliated with the Performing Arts School & Camp. |

STUDENT DISCOUNTS!
Sibling Discount:
One student in a family is considered primary and pays the published tuition cost. Each additional sibling receives a 5% discount. Siblings are not required to attend the same camp program.
Locals Residential Discount:
All year-round residents of Routt County who register for a residential camp session will receive a 10% discount off the total cost of tuition.
Referral Discount: Returning 2009 students who refer another enrolled student are eligible to receive an additional 5% discount off their tuition cost. The referred student must not have attended any other Perry-Mansfield program in the past and must list you as the referral source on their application. The discount cannot be multiplied for additional referrals.
